Abstract:
Disclosed are a vascular disease examination system capable of examining and diagnosing vascular diseases such as arterial obliteration by determining the feature quantities of blood flow velocity waveforms or blood pressure waveforms or blood flow rates, and a bypass vascular diagnosing system. A blood flow velocity or blood pressure at a target location of the body is measured and the measurement signal is supplied to a vascular disease examination system 1. The measurement signal is converted into a digital signal at an A/D conversion unit 2 and temporarily stored in a memory unit 3. A waveform analysis unit 4 determines the feature quantity of a blood flow waveform (or blood pressure waveform) , for displaying on an output unit 5. The feature quantity includes a time constant, Fourier transform value, differentiated value, integrated value, rise/fall time, and sharpness or gradient of rise. Feature quantity of a blood flow velocity waveform (or blood pressure waveform) indicated in numeric value enables a correct examination/diagnosis.
